CoreGRID Workshop - Making Grids Work | 2008

Towards gcm re-configuration - extending specification by norms

Alessandro Basso; Alexander Bolotov

We continue investigation of formal specification of Grid Component systems by temporal logics and subsequent application of temporal resolution as a verification technique. This time we enrich the specification language by the ability to capture norms which enables us to formally define a concept of a re-configuration. We aim at integrating a software tool for automated specification as well as verification to ensure a reliable and dynamically re-configurable model.


Archive | 2008

Behavioural model of component-Based Grid Environments

Alessandro Basso; Alexander Bolotov; Vladimir Getov

In component-based Grid environments, we analyse the problem of formal specification of their behaviour by introducing an automata-based model. We show how to construct this new framework from the analysis of states of components and how to apply it to a reconfiguration scenario in a dynamic distributed system environment. We aim at building a framework for future integration of these developments in a software tool for runtime automated specification and verifi-cation, ensuring a reliable dynamically reconfigurable component model.


secure software integration and reliability improvement | 2009

Temporal Specification and Deductive Verification of a Distributed Component Model and Its Environment

Alessandro Basso; Alexander Bolotov; Vladimir Getov

In this paper we investigate the formalisation of distributed and long-running stateful systems using our normative temporal specification framework. We analyse aspects of a component-oriented Grid system, and the benefits of having a logic-based tool to perform automated and safe dynamic reconfiguration of its components. We describe which parts of this Grid system are involved in the reconfiguration process and detail the translation procedure into a state-based formal specification. Subsequently, we apply deductive verification to test whether dynamic reconfiguration can be performed. Finally, we analyse the procedure required to update our model for reconfiguration and justify the validity and the advantages of our methodology.


Information Systems | 2006

Specilfication and Verilfication of Rleconfiguration Protocols in Grid Comnponent Systemns

Alessandro Basso; Alexander Boltov; Artie Basukoski; Vladimir Getov; Ludovic Henrio; Mariusz Urbański

In this work we present an approach for the formal specification and verification of the reconfiguration protocols in grid component systems. We consider fractal, a modular and extensible component model. As a specification tool we invoke a specific temporal language, separated clausal normal form, which has been shown to be capable of expressing any ECTiL+ expression, thus, we are able to express the complex fairness properties of a component system. The structure of the normal enables us to directly apply the deductive verification technique, temporal resolution defined in the framework of branching-time temporal logic
